About N-(2,5-dimethoxyphenyl)-2-[(4-oxo-5-propoxy-1H-pyridin-2-yl)methylsulfinyl]acetamide
N-(2,5-dimethoxyphenyl)-2-[(4-oxo-5-propoxy-1H-pyridin-2-yl)methylsulfinyl]acetamide (PubChem CID 123123377) has the molecular formula C19H24N2O6S
and a molecular weight of 408.48 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is N-(2,5-dimethoxyphenyl)-2-[(4-oxo-5-propoxy-1H-pyridin-2-yl)methylsulfinyl]acetamide.

What is the SMILES notation for N-(2,5-dimethoxyphenyl)-2-[(4-oxo-5-propoxy-1H-pyridin-2-yl)methylsulfinyl]acetamide?
The canonical SMILES for N-(2,5-dimethoxyphenyl)-2-[(4-oxo-5-propoxy-1H-pyridin-2-yl)methylsulfinyl]acetamide is CCCOc1c[nH]c(CS(=O)CC(=O)Nc2cc(OC)ccc2OC)cc1=O.
What is the InChIKey of N-(2,5-dimethoxyphenyl)-2-[(4-oxo-5-propoxy-1H-pyridin-2-yl)methylsulfinyl]acetamide?
The InChIKey is UDQZUHBTIHGFQJ-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C19H24N2O6S/c1-4-7-27-18-10-20-13(8-16(18)22)11-28(24)12-19(23)21-15-9-14(25-2)5-6-17(15)26-3/h5-6,8-10H,4,7,11-12H2,1-3H3,(H,20,22)(H,21,23).
What are the key properties of N-(2,5-dimethoxyphenyl)-2-[(4-oxo-5-propoxy-1H-pyridin-2-yl)methylsulfinyl]acetamide?
N-(2,5-dimethoxyphenyl)-2-[(4-oxo-5-propoxy-1H-pyridin-2-yl)methylsulfinyl]acetamide has a molecular weight of 408.48 g/mol, XLogP of 2.07, 10 rotatable bonds, 2 hydrogen bond donors, and 6 hydrogen bond acceptors.
